Understanding Nile FM's Digital Transformation in Egyptian Radio

Nile FM 104.2 has successfully evolved from a conventional FM broadcaster into a comprehensive digital media brand. This transformation reflects broader shifts in radio online Egypt, where smartphone penetration has reached 65% and internet users now exceed 72 million. The station's digital integration encompasses live streaming via its website and mobile app, robust social media presence across Facebook, Instagram, and Twitter, and podcast distribution of popular shows.

For media buyers, this multi-channel approach delivers unprecedented value. A single radio advertising campaign on Nile FM now automatically extends across digital touchpoints, creating multiple impression opportunities without additional costs. The station's audience doesn't just tune in during drive time anymore; they stream content during work hours, engage with social posts throughout the day, and download podcast episodes for later consumption.

This digital expansion has particularly strengthened Nile FM's position among Egypt's affluent, English-speaking demographic. The typical listener profile includes expatriates, bilingual Egyptians aged 25-45, business professionals, and university-educated consumers with above-average purchasing power. These are precisely the decision-makers and high-value customers that multinational brands, luxury retailers, automotive companies, and premium service providers seek to reach.

Audience Demographics and Digital Reach Metrics

The power of Nile FM 104.2 digital integration becomes evident when examining the numbers. The station reaches approximately 2.5 million listeners weekly through traditional FM broadcasting across Greater Cairo, Alexandria, and the Red Sea region. However, digital platforms have expanded this reach significantly. The Nile FM mobile app generates over 150,000 monthly active users, while the website attracts approximately 400,000 unique visitors monthly. Social media engagement adds another dimension, with Facebook followers exceeding 1.8 million and Instagram engagement rates consistently outperforming industry benchmarks.

This expanded digital presence transforms the value proposition for radio advertising. Traditional 30-second spot campaigns now benefit from complementary digital exposure. When listeners miss live broadcasts, they catch up via streaming. When they hear compelling ads on-air, they often engage with the brand's social presence immediately. This convergence of traditional and digital creates a multiplier effect that savvy media buyers leverage for maximum impact.

The demographic profile remains remarkably consistent across platforms. Digital listeners skew slightly younger (25-35 versus 30-45 for traditional radio), but purchasing power and lifestyle characteristics remain aligned. Both audiences demonstrate high engagement with entertainment, dining, travel, technology, and lifestyle content. This consistency allows brands to develop unified creative messaging that works across all Nile FM touchpoints.

Pricing Structures and Media Buying Considerations

Understanding Nile FM 104.2 rate structures helps media planners allocate budgets effectively. Traditional radio spots range from approximately $200 for off-peak 30-second slots to $800-1,200 for prime drive-time placement. However, the digital integration element substantially enhances this value proposition. Many packages now include complementary social media mentions, website banner placement, or podcast integration, effectively delivering multi-platform exposure at single-platform pricing.

Peak times remain the most valuable inventory. Morning drive time (6:00-9:00 AM) and evening drive time (4:00-7:00 PM) command premium rates due to maximum listenership, but increasingly, media buyers recognize value in daytime slots that combine moderate FM audiences with strong digital streaming numbers. The 10:00 AM to 2:00 PM daypart, once considered secondary inventory, now attracts office workers streaming via desktop and mobile devices, creating unexpected reach among professional demographics.

Package deals often deliver superior ROI compared to individual spot purchases. Multi-week campaigns typically include rate reductions of 15-25%, plus added-value digital components. Seasonal considerations also impact pricing, with Ramadan commanding premium rates due to altered listening patterns and increased consumer spending, while summer months may offer negotiating opportunities as expatriate audiences travel.

Digital Content Partnership Opportunities

Beyond traditional spot advertising, Nile FM's digital integration opens creative partnership possibilities. Branded content segments allow advertisers to align with specific shows or personalities, creating native advertising that feels organic rather than interruptive. These partnerships typically perform exceptionally well in digital environments where audiences actively seek entertainment and information rather than passively consuming content.

Podcast sponsorships represent particularly strong opportunities. Nile FM produces downloadable versions of popular programs, and podcast listeners demonstrate higher engagement and attention levels compared to live radio audiences. Pre-roll, mid-roll, and post-roll sponsorships in podcast content often achieve completion rates exceeding 80%, substantially higher than typical digital audio.

Social media integration adds another dimension. Campaign packages frequently include presenter mentions on personal social accounts, station posts featuring advertiser content, and competition integrations that drive audience participation. These digital extensions amplify campaign reach and create measurement opportunities through trackable links, hashtags, and engagement metrics.

Maximizing Campaign Effectiveness in the Egyptian Market

Successful radio advertising in Egypt requires cultural awareness and strategic timing. Egyptian audiences respond particularly well to humor, family-oriented messaging, and endorsements from trusted personalities. Creative that performs well in Western markets may require adaptation to resonate with local sensibilities, even when targeting English-speaking demographics.

Language considerations also matter. While Nile FM broadcasts in English, many listeners are bilingual Egyptians who think in both languages. Subtle incorporation of Arabic phrases or culturally relevant references can significantly boost engagement without alienating expatriate audiences. The station's commercial production team understands these nuances and can guide creative development.

Timing campaigns around cultural events maximizes impact. Ramadan, Eid celebrations, summer travel season, and back-to-school periods create distinct consumption patterns and purchase intentions. Aligning radio advertising with these seasonal moments, combined with digital extensions through social media and streaming platforms, creates powerful synergies.
